The ICC Under-19 Men’s Cricket World Cup 2026, scheduled from 15 January to 6 February 2026, features 16 teams in a 50-over format, co-hosted by Zimbabwe and Namibia, with the top teams advancing to the Super Six stage. Fans can expect high-octane matches and rising cricket stars throughout the tournament.

The tournament kicked off with four groups playing round-robin matches, with the top three teams from each group advancing to the Super Six, carrying forward points toward the semifinals and final. ICC Under-19 World Cup 2026: Tournament Guide

This table explains the ICC Under-19 World Cup 2026 format, which includes 41 matches scheduled over 23 days. The tournament is hosted across multiple venues in Zimbabwe and Namibia, showcasing competitive youth cricket and a well-structured progression from group stages to the final.

Tournament StageNumber of MatchesDuration / Dates
Total Matches4115 January – 6 February 2026 (23 days)
Group Stage2415 January – 24 January 2026
Super Six Stage1225 January – 1 February 2026
Knockout Stage33 February – 6 February 2026

The tournament opens with a 24-match group stage running from 15 to 24 January, where 16 teams compete for places in the Super Six. The Super Six phase, played from 25 January to 1 February, consists of 12 matches and is vital, as teams carry forward points toward semi-final qualification. The competition wraps up with three knockout games, two semi-finals and the final, scheduled between 3 and 6 February, deciding the ultimate champion.

ICC Under-19 World Cup 2026: Knockout Qualification Format

This table explains how teams progress to the knockout stage in the ICC Under-19 World Cup 2026.

Tournament StageTeams InvolvedQualification RuleOutcome
Group Stage16 teams (4 groups of 4)Top 3 teams from each group qualify12 teams advance to Super Six
Plate CompetitionGroup-stage 4th place teamsBottom team from each groupPlay classification matches
Super Six Stage12 qualified teamsPoints carried forward from group stageRankings decided by points & NRR
Super Six Result2 groupsTop 2 teams from each Super Six group4 teams qualify for semi-finals
Semi-Finals4 teamsKnockout matchesWinners advance
Final2 teamsWinner of semi-finalsICC Under-19 World Cup Champion

Group-stage outcomes have a direct impact on the Super Six standings, as only points gained against teams that qualify are carried forward. A heavy loss can significantly affect Net Run Rate (NRR), which often proves crucial when teams are tied on points.

India U19 and Australia U19 enter the ICC Under-19 World Cup 2026 as front-runners, with impressive historical records. India is the competition’s most decorated team, lifting the trophy five times and regularly reaching the knockout stages. Australia, the defending 2024 champions, boasts four titles and a proven pathway from youth to senior cricket. Pakistan U19 remains a dangerous contender, backed by multiple championships and a tradition of producing high-quality fast bowlers. South Africa has also consistently featured among the top teams. While established powers dominate history, emerging nations frequently deliver surprises, ensuring shifting standings, unexpected upsets, and evolving semi-final and title prospects throughout the tournament.

FAQs

What is the ICC Under-19 World Cup 2026 Points Table?

The points table shows each team’s matches played, wins, losses, no results, points, and Net Run Rate (NRR) during the tournament.

How many points are awarded for a win?

A team receives 2 points for a win, 1 point for a tie or no result, and 0 points for a loss.

How are teams ranked if points are equal?

If teams finish on the same points, Net Run Rate (NRR) is used to decide rankings.

How does the group stage points table work?

All 16 teams are divided into four groups, playing round-robin matches to earn points for Super Six qualification.

Do points carry forward to the Super Six stage?

Yes, only points earned against other Super Six-qualified teams are carried forward.

How many teams qualify for the Super Six?

The top three teams from each group qualify for the Super Six stage.
